What Organisms Have Two Flagella?

What Organisms Have Two Flagella? In fact, each dinoflagellate has two flagella, long clusters of protein strands which can be manipulated for movement. The two flagella are of different sorts– that is, they are constructed and move in different ways. Which group of organisms has two flagella? Complete answer: Dinoflagellates are marine eukaryotes. Which Of The Following Is Characteristic Of Ciliates?

Which Of The Following Is Characteristic Of Ciliates? Ciliates are a group of protozoans that contain a bunch of hair-like organelles called cilia. One main characteristic of Ciliates is that they often multi-nucleate. This term refers to eukaryotic cells that contain various or at-least more than one nucleus per cell.
